Las Vegas is known as the Wedding
Capital of the World and is famous for it’s wedding
chapels, drive thru ceremonies and Elvis nuptials.
Although these popular options are available, there are
also numerous other ways to say I do in Las Vegas. Many
hotels, resorts, and other locations in the Las Vegas
area offer some very elegant and breathtaking wedding
sites.
Lake Las Vegas is quickly becoming a
very popular destination for weddings in the Las Vegas
area. Located about 17 miles from the famous Strip, this
stunning lake location offers ritzy resorts and amazing
views of the mountains, desert, and Vegas skyline. There
are many wedding venues to choose from at Lake Las
Vegas. The Ritz Carlton Lake Las Vegas offers several
including a cobblestone courtyard in a garden and a
lakeside location with a bridge and gazebo. They also
have a beach venue which provides a waterfall, bridge
and a dock in a lagoon which acts as the altar. The
MonteLago Village Resort Lake Las Vegas also has several
wedding sites to choose from. A balcony in a hotel
suite, a gazebo, and golf course locations are just a
few of the wedding settings offered there. Another great
option they offer are yacht weddings on Lake Las Vegas.
The Wedding Company of Las Vegas offers a wedding
package that offers a gondola wedding on Lake Las Vegas
and includes helicopter transportation to and from the
wedding as well as a helicopter tour of the Las Vegas
lights.
Las Vegas is home to many top notch golf
courses and country clubs which also provide amazing
wedding sites. At Siena Golf Club, you can have your
ceremony on their lawn under a wedding arbor. You can
then hold your reception in their clubhouse or community
center which both offer wonderful views of the golf
course, a lake, and the Las Vegas Strip.
Mount Charleston is another wonderful
alternative for a wedding in the Las Vegas area. Located
about a 45 minute drive from the Strip, this beautiful
mountain locale offers not only cooler weather than the
Valley but also stunning scenery. The Mount Charleston
Hotel provides packages for wedding ceremonies and
receptions. You can have your wedding ceremony outdoors
with all the beauty of the mountain surrounding you.
Receptions can also be arranged outside, or can be held
inside the hotel.
